Sinaloa Governor Ruben Rocha Returns to Office Amid US Criminal Charges

Ruben Rocha, the governor of Sinaloa, has resumed his duties despite being accused of collaborating with a drug cartel by the Trump administration. The allegations stem from criminal charges filed in the United States.
